Comparison of T1 vs. T2 vs. Flair (Brain) Comparison of T1 vs. T1 with Gadolinium Comparison of … WebJul 22, 2024 · Fluid attenuated inversion recovery (FLAIR) is a special inversion recovery sequence with a long inversion time. This removes signal from the cerebrospinal fluid in the resulting images 1. Brain tissue on FLAIR images appears similar to T2 weighted images with grey matter brighter than white matter but CSF is dark instead of bright. Physics

WebMar 6, 2024 · Adding DWI and resection cavity FLAIR signal alteration improves the diagnostic performance of BT-RADS category 3. BT-RADS is a structured reporting system of post-treatment glioma. BT-RADS category 3 carries a probability of recurrent malignancy versus treatment-related changes.
